Abstract
- Luteolin is a flavonoid that occurs naturally in various fruits and vegetables. It has been shown that this compound possesses an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ties, which can significantly inhibit pathogenesis. A substantial amount of research has been performed to execute this compound’s role as an anticancer agent. Moreover, luteolin has the ability to block cell proliferation, inflammation, angiogenesis, and other cell signaling molecules that can contribute to cancer growth. This review aims to shed light on the efforts to present potential targets for luteolin in different cancers. Moreover, this review also explores the synergistic potential of this compound with other anticancer drugs. Despite its promising health-promoting benefits, it is essential to note that further research is needed based on safety, mechanism of action, efficacy, and clinical trials to reconnoiter its potential benefits in cancer management.
